  • Bioactivity :

    Okadaic acid is a potent polyether marine toxin that primarily accumulates in the digestive glands of marine mollusks. It is a highly effective and selective inhibitor of protein phosphatases (PPs) . By inhibiting these phosphatases, okadaic acid increases the phosphorylation levels of various proteins, acts as a tumor promoter, and induces tau protein phosphorylation. It can be used to establish models of Alzheimer’s disease and skin cancer.
